REBN BEARISH

REBN exhibits critical financial instability, characterized by a Piotroski F-Score of 4/9 and the absence of a calculable Altman Z-Score or Graham Number due to negative equity. The company is facing a severe liquidity crisis with a current ratio of 0.08, indicating an inability to meet short-term obligations. While gross margins are healthy at 55.51%, massive operating losses (-224.67% margin) and negative book value (P/B -4.66) suggest a high risk of insolvency. Recent short-term price gains appear speculative and are not supported by fundamental improvements.

Strengths
Positive gross margin of 55.51% indicating product-level viability
Modest year-over-year revenue growth of 7.80%
Recent short-term price momentum (+31.9% over 1 month)
Risks
Extreme liquidity risk with a current ratio of 0.08 and quick ratio of 0.02
Negative shareholder equity as evidenced by a Price/Book of -4.66
Severe operational inefficiency with an operating margin of -224.67%
